Pontianak, Borneo vs Barnaul Climate & Distance Between

Russia flag
  • The distance between Pontianak, Borneo, Indonesia and Barnaul, Russia is approximately 6,403 km or 3,979 mi.
  • To reach Pontianak, Borneo in this distance one would set out from Barnaul bearing 148.9° or SSE and follow the great circles arc to approach Pontianak, Borneo bearing 162.1° or SSE .
  • Pontianak, Borneo has a tropical rainforest climate (Af) whereas Barnaul has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b).
  • Pontianak, Borneo is in or near the tropical moist forest biome whereas Barnaul is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 25.9 °C (46.5°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 34.7 °C (62.5°F) less in Pontianak, Borneo.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ly continental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 2757.6 mm (108.6 in) more which is equivalent to 2757.6 l/m² (67.68 US gal/ft²) or 27,576,000 l/ha (2,948,057 US gal/ac) more. About 7 1/2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 38° higher in Pontianak, Borneo than in Barnaul.
